Vet team: Get a vacay day for upselling
Hey, practice owners: Sometimes a day off is worth more than a $5 Starbucks gift card to a veterinary team member. This manager figured that out.

A smart attendee at CVC Kansas City shared this tip with us. We liked it: "Upselling" sounds bad, but in the veterinary practice, isn't it really a veterinary team member who made sure a pet owner knew just how important every aspect of preventive care is?
We give a paid day off to the employee who upsells the most in a month (parasite preventives, vaccines, toe nail trims, etc.).
- Cathy Murray
